Thompson Siegel & Walmsley LLC lifted its position in Copart, Inc. (NASDAQ:CPRT - Free Report) by 9.9% during the 4th quarter, according to the company in its most recent filing with the SEC. The fund owned 79,247 shares of the business services provider's stock after purchasing an additional 7,150 shares during the quarter. Thompson Siegel & Walmsley LLC's holdings in Copart were worth $4,548,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

Copart Profile

(Free Report)

Copart, Inc provides online auctions and vehicle remarketing services. It offers a range of services for processing and selling vehicles over the Internet through its Virtual Bidding Third Generation Internet auction-style sales technology on behalf of vehicle sellers, insurance companies, banks and finance companies, charities, and fleet operators and dealers, as well as individual owners.
